The APEO-free formulation in Acronal® PLUS 7865 provides significant environmental and health advantages. APEO (Alkylphenol Ethoxylates) are surfactants that have been linked to environmental persistence and endocrine disruption in aquatic ecosystems. By completely eliminating APEO, Acronal® PLUS 7865 supports sustainable construction practices, enables compliance with increasingly stringent environmental regulations and eco-label requirements, reduces environmental impact throughout the product lifecycle, and improves workplace safety by eliminating substances of concern. This makes it ideal for manufacturers developing environmentally responsible waterproofing products that meet green building certification criteria. The APEO-free chemistry does not compromise performance - Acronal® PLUS 7865 delivers the same exceptional mechanical strength, flexibility, and water resistance expected from premium waterproofing polymers while meeting modern sustainability standards. Dirt pickup resistance is a critical performance characteristic for exposed waterproofing systems, particularly for roofs, terraces, and facades. When waterproofing coatings attract and retain dirt, dust, and atmospheric pollutants, several problems occur: aesthetic degradation with visible discoloration and staining affecting building appearance, accelerated aging as dirt particles can trap moisture and promote polymer degradation, reduced reflectivity for light-colored coatings intended for solar heat reflection, maintenance burden requiring frequent cleaning to maintain appearance and performance, and potential for biological growth as accumulated dirt can support algae and mildew development. Acronal® PLUS 7865's excellent dirt pickup resistance is achieved through its optimized polymer composition and fine particle size distribution, creating a smooth, dense film surface that resists soil adhesion. This characteristic is particularly valuable for high-visibility applications like commercial building facades, premium residential roofing systems, and architectural structures where long-term aesthetic preservation is important. The dirt pickup resistance contributes to extended service life and reduced lifecycle costs by maintaining both appearance and protective performance over many years of environmental exposure.

The optimal dosage of Acronal® PLUS 7865 depends on the specific application and desired performance characteristics. For elastomeric waterproofing coatings, typical polymer content ranges from 25-40% of total wet formulation, with higher percentages providing enhanced elasticity and water resistance. For waterproofing mastic coatings, 30-50% polymer content is common, balancing viscosity, thixotropy, and final film properties. Facade protective coatings may use 20-35% depending on breathability requirements and substrate type. These percentages refer to the polymer dispersion as supplied, not dry polymer content. Formulations must be balanced with appropriate fillers (calcium carbonate, talc, silica), pigments for UV protection and desired color, rheology modifiers and thixotropes for application properties, defoamers and wetting agents, preservatives for in-can stability, and potentially crosslinkers for enhanced chemical and water resistance. The solids content of Acronal® PLUS 7865 (approximately 50%) should be considered when calculating dry film build and coverage rates. Laboratory trials are essential to optimize the formulation for your specific performance targets including tensile strength and elongation, water resistance and permeability, adhesion to relevant substrates, application viscosity and workability, and cost-performance balance. Proper storage is critical for Acronal® PLUS 7865 to maintain its performance characteristics. Store at temperatures between 10-30°C in tightly closed containers or with storage tank headspace saturated with water vapor to prevent evaporation and skin formation. CRITICAL: The product must not contact bare iron, copper, or their alloys as these metals cause contamination, discoloration, and potential coagulation - use stainless steel, HDPE, or properly coated storage vessels and transfer equipment. Protect from freezing as exposure to frost causes irreversible coagulation and complete loss of usability. Similarly, avoid storage above 40°C and protect from direct sunlight which can accelerate aging. While the product contains transport stabilization, additional preservatives should be added for long-term storage to prevent microbial growth in the aqueous medium - consult VUBS Corporation for compatible biocide recommendations. Tank hygiene is essential: regular cleaning prevents contamination buildup, and proper maintenance extends product shelf life and prevents quality issues. The product has a shelf life of approximately nine months from manufacture date under recommended storage conditions. Implement FIFO (first-in-first-out) inventory rotation,maintain proper labeling with batch numbers and receipt dates, and conduct periodic visual inspection for signs of settling, skin formation, coagulation, or off-odor.
